Understanding the Long-Term Health Effects of Medicinal Cannabis

While studies are continually exploring the possible benefits of medicinal cannabis, a full understanding of its long-term impact on health remains . Current evidence suggest a few conceivable risks, such as potential alterations in brain function, notably with teenage use. Further investigation is essential to thoroughly ascertain the lasting impact on cardiovascular health, pulmonary function, and the risk of developing psychiatric conditions . It is crucial that users discuss these potential risks with their medical providers before pursuing medicinal cannabis therapy .
